Introduction to Network and Network Security

Networks are essential components of modern computing and communication systems. They enable devices to communicate with each other, share resources, and access the internet. A network consists of interconnected devices like computers, servers, routers, switches, and more. These devices exchange data using various protocols, such as TCP/IP, UDP, HTTP, and FTP.

Network security is a critical aspect of maintaining the integrity, confidentiality, and availability of data transmitted over networks. It involves implementing measures to protect networks from unauthorized access, cyberattacks, data breaches, and other security threats. Common network security technologies include firewalls, intrusion detection systems, virtual private networks (VPNs), and encryption.

Understanding network security is vital for safeguarding sensitive information and preventing unauthorized access to network resources. Security threats, such as malware, phishing attacks, ransomware, and DDoS attacks, can compromise network integrity and lead to significant data breaches.
